JACKSON, Wyo. — Snow King is excited to welcome guests back to the summit for a fun summer season.

The Scenic Gondola, Aurora Restaurant and the Snow King Observatory & Planetarium are officially open for the summer season — and open daily.

Aurora’s new summer menu

Aurora Restaurant returns with a new, expanded menu created by Chef Brandon Hicks, featuring fresh summer flavors, hearty mountain cuisine and a refined wine and cocktail list.

The Aurora patio has opened, offering additional seating and the opportunity to dine along the glass with panoramic views of Jackson Hole.

All other activities (Snow King Zip Line, Treetop Adventure, Mini-golf, Cowboy Coaster) open for the summer season on Friday, May 23.
